WordPress Tips – Page Template -
CMS တစ္ခုျဖစ္တဲ့ WordPress ရဲ႕ စမ္းေဆာင္ႏိုင္မႈေတြကေတာ့ ရွာေဖြေလေတြ႕ရွိေလ ဆိုသလိုပါပဲ။ ကၽြန္ေတာ္တို႕လို Coding ေတြ PHP ေတြ CSS ေတြ မကၽြမ္းက်င္သူေတြအဖို႕ကေတာ့ စြမ္းေဆာင္ႏိုင္မႈအျပည့္ ရယူအသံုးျပဳဖို႕ Premium Themes ေတြနဲ႕ Plugins ေတြကို အားကိုးရမွာျဖစ္ပါတယ္။ WordPress မွာ Post နဲ႕ Page ဆိုၿပီး ခြဲထားတာ သိၿပီးသားျဖစ္ပါလိမ့္မယ္။ Post ကေတာ့ ပံုမွန္ဘေလာ့ဂ္ပို႕စ္ေတြျဖစ္ၿပီး သီးျခားျဖစ္တာေတြကို Page မွာ ေရးေလ့ရွိၾကပါတယ္ (ဥပမာ About me, Contact Info စသည္ျဖင့္) ။ အဲဒီ Page တစ္ခုခ်င္းစီကို ႏွစ္သက္သလို ဒီဇိုင္းပံုစံ ေျပာင္းေပးလို႕ရပါတယ္။
Popularity: 61% [?]
WordPress Turbo
Wordpress 2.6 ကေနစၿပီး Dashboard မွာ Turbo ဆိုတာေလးပါလာတာ ေတြ႕ၾကပါလိမ့္မယ္။

Turbo ဘာအတြက္သံုးတာလဲ
ကၽြန္ေတာ္တို႕ Wordpress ဘေလာ့ဂ္မွာ ပို႕စ္တင္သည္ျဖစ္ေစ၊ သူငယ္ခ်င္းေတြရဲ႕ လင့္ခ္ ထည့္သည္ျဖစ္ေစ၊ ေျပာင္းလဲမႈ တခုခု ျပဳလုပ္တိုင္း လိုအပ္တာေတြကို Web Server မွ ဆြဲယူရပါတယ္။ ဒါေၾကာင့္ Loading အခ်ိန္ၾကာပါတယ္။ Turbo ကို အသံုးျပဳထားရင္ Wordpress ရဲ႕ ဖိုင္အခ်ိဳ႕ကို local computer မွာ သိမ္းထားေပးတာေၾကာင့္ အျမန္ႏံႈး သိသိသာသာ တတ္လာတာကို ေတြ႕ရပါလိမ့္မယ္။ အထူးသျဖင့္ ကြန္နက္ရွင္ ေႏွးတဲ့ ေနရာမွာဆိုရင္ ပိုသိသာပါတယ္။
Wordpress Turbo ဟာ Google Gears API ကို အသံုးျပဳထားတာ ျဖစ္လို႕ Web developers တြ ရင္းႏွီးၿပီးသား ျဖစ္ပါလိမ့္မယ္။ အသံုးၿပဳဖို႕အတြက္ Turbo ဆိုတာေလးကို ႏွိပ္ေပးလိုက္ရင္ Gears Install လုပ္ဖို႕အတြက္ ေဒါင္းလုပ္ ခ်ခိုင္းပါလိမ့္မယ္။ ညႊန္ၾကားတဲ့ အတိုင္းဆက္လုပ္ေပးသြားၿပီး အားလံုးၿပီးစီးသြားရင္ ယခုလိုေတြ႕ရပါမယ္။

Wordprss Turbo ဟာ Firefox 2-3, IE 6-7 တို႕နဲ႕ အလုပ္လုပ္ၿပီး Google Chrome အသံုးျပဳသူမ်ား အတြက္ကေတာ့ Wordpress 2.62 ကို upgrade ျပဳလုပ္ဖုိ႕ လိုအပ္ပါတယ္။ သတိျပဳရမွာက Local computer မွာ လိုအပ္တဲ့ဖိုင္ေတြကို ေဆ့ဖ္ လုပ္ထားတာ ျဖစ္တာေၾကာင့္ အင္တာနက္ ကေဖးမွာ အသံုးျပဳသူေတြအတြက္ အဆင္မေျပႏိုင္ပါ။ Turbo နဲ႕ Gears အေၾကာင္း အေသးစိတ္ေလ့လာလိုလွ်င္ ေအာက္ပါလင့္ခ္မ်ားမွာ ဖတ္ရႈႏိုင္ပါတယ္။
Popularity: 57% [?]
WordPress နဲ႕ ျမန္မာေဖာင့္
WordPress Blog မွာ ျမန္မာလိုေကာင္းစြာေပၚဖို႕ အတြက္ အသံုးျပဳမယ့္ theme ရဲ႕ style.css မွာ ေဇာ္ဂ်ီေဖာင့္ Assign လုပ္ေပးရပါမယ္။ ဒါဆိုရင္ ေဇာ္ဂ်ီေဖာင့္ ရွိတဲ့ ကြန္ျပဴတာတိုင္းမွာ ျမန္မာလို ေကာင္းစြာျမင္ရပါလိမ့္မယ္။ ေဇာ္ဂ်ီေဖာင့္မရွိတဲ့ စက္ေတြအတြက္ eot လုပ္ေပးထားခ်င္ေသးတယ္ ဆိုရင္ေတာ့ ဘေလာ့စေပါ့ eot ထည့္နည္း အတိုင္း style.css ရဲ႕ ေပၚဆံုးမွာ ထည့္ေပးလို႕ရပါတယ္။ ဒါဆို ေဇာ္ဂ်ီေဖာင့္ မရွိလဲ ဖတ္လို႕ရပါၿပီ။ သတိျပဳရမွာက eot လုပ္ထားေပမယ့္ ေဇာ္ဂ်ီကို sytle.css မွာ Assign လုပ္မထားရင္ေတာ့ ျမန္မာလို ေပၚမွာ မဟုတ္ပါဘူး။ ေဇာ္ဂ်ီေဖာင့္ကိုလဲ ေကာင္းစြာ Assign လုပ္ထားၿပီးၿပီ ဒါေပမယ့္ ??????? ေတြပဲ ျမင္ေနရတယ္ ဆိုလွ်င္ MySQL database မွာ ျပသနာ တတ္တာ ျဖစ္ႏိုင္ပါတယ္။ MySQL Database Character Encodinig ဟာ UTF-8 ျဖစ္ကို ျဖစ္ရပါမယ္။ မဟုတ္ရင္ ဘယ္လို ေဇာ္ဂ်ီေဖာင့္ Assign လုပ္လုပ္ ျမန္မာလို ျမင္ရမွာ မဟုတ္ပါဘူး။
Hosting ေတြက ေပးထားတဲ့ Script နဲ႕ WordPress Install လုပ္တဲ့အခါ MySQL Encoding က UTF-8 မဟုတ္ပဲ အျခားဟာေတြ ျဖစ္ေနတတ္ပါတယ္ ( ဥပမာ။ 000webhosting ) ။ MySQL UTF-8 ဟုတ္မဟုတ္ စစ္ေဆးၾကည့္ဖို႕အတြက္ Hosting ရဲ႕ Control Panel / PHP Admin ကို ၀င္ၾကည့္ရပါမယ္။ UTF-8 နဲ႕ မေတြ႕ပဲ ဒီလိုမ်ိဳး latin1_general_ci သို႕မဟုတ္ အျခားတခုခု ဆိုရင္ MySQL ေၾကာင့္ဆိုတာ ေသခ်ာပါၿပီ။
Popularity: 61% [?]
Read more…
Link Jumps to More or Top of Page
WordPress မွာ ပို႕စ္ အရမ္းရွည္ေနလွ်င္ ပို႕စ္ေခါက္ဖို႕ (သို႕) ပို႕စ္ေခါင္းစဥ္ကို ႏွိပ္မွ အျပည့္အစံု ဖတ္ႏိုင္ေစဖို႕ More tag ထည့္သြင္းေပးထားႏိုင္ပါတယ္။
ပိုစ္ အျပည့္အစံု ဖတ္ရႈဖို႕ ၀င္ေရာက္လိုက္လွ်င္ More tag ထည့္ထားတဲ့ ေနာက္ပိုင္းကို တန္းေရာက္သြားၿပီး စာျမည္းအျဖစ္ ေဖာ္ျပထားတာေတြ ျပန္ဖတ္ဖို႕ Scroll up ျပန္ဆြဲေပးေနရတာ သတိျပဳမိၾကပါလိမ့္မယ္။ Post title (သို႕) More… ဆိုတာေလးကို ႏွိပ္လိုက္ရင္ ပို႕စ္အစ ကေန စၿပီး ေဖၚျပခ်င္တယ္ဆိုရင္ ⁄wp-includes/post-template.php မွာ အနည္းေျပာင္းလဲေပးရပါမယ္။
. "#more-$id\">$more_link_text</a>";
ဆိုတဲ့ ကုဒ္ ကိုရွာၿပီး
."\">$more_link_text</a>";
နဲ႕အစား ထိုးေပးလိုက္ရင္ အဆင္ေျပပါၿပီ။ တစ္ခုပဲ သတိျပဳရမွာက WordPress Upgrade လုပ္လိုက္ရင္ ျပဳလုပ္ထားတာ ေပ်ာက္သြားမွာျဖစ္ပါတယ္။
Designing the More Tag
More Tag နဲ႕ေခါက္ထားတဲ့ ပို႕စ္မွာ More… , Read more… ဆိုတာေတြအစား ႏွစ္သက္ရာ ေျပာင္းလဲခ်င္တယ္ ဆိုရင္ အသံုးျပဳထားတဲ့ Theme ရဲ႕ Index.php မွာ ေျပာင္းေပးရပါမယ္။
<?php the_content(__('Read more'));?>
အဲဒီက Read more ဆိုတဲ့ေနရာမွာ လိုခ်င္သလို ေျပာင္းေရးေပးလိုက္ရင္ အဆင္ေျပပါၿပီ။ Post title ကိုပါ ေဖာ္ျပခ်င္တယ္ဆိုရင္
<?php the_content("...continue reading the story
called " . get_the_title('', '', false)); ?>
ဒီလို ေျပာင္းေပးလို႕ရပါတယ္။ ပံုေလးေတြပါ ထည့္ခ်င္တယ္ဆိုရင္
<?php the_content('Read more...<img src="/images/leaf.gif"
alt="read more" title="Read more..." />'); ?>
အခုလိုထည့္ေပးလိုက္ရင္ အဆင္ေျပပါၿပီ။
Popularity: 28% [?]
Wordpress တြင္ Login password ေမ့သြားလွ်င္
<မွတ္ခ်က္။ ။ ရာမညဖိုးလျပည့္ ဘေလာ့ဂ္မွ ကူးယူေဖာ္ျပပါသည္။>
တကယ္လို႕ မိမိ login ၀င္လို႕ password ေမ့ရင္ အဲဒီမွာ Lost your password? ကုိနွိပ္ရင္လဲ မိမိထည့္ထားတဲ့ အီးေမလ္းကုိ ပို႕ ေပးပါတယ္ ။ ဒါေပမဲ့ အီးေမလ္းလဲမလာဘူးဆိုရင္(ဒါမွမဟုတ္ hack ခံထိလို႕ အီးေမလ္းပါေျပာင္းခံထိထားရင္) ဒီနည္းကို သံုးလို႕ ရပါတယ္။ ဒီနည္းဟာ Localhost မွာလဲ တူတူပါပဲ ။
ပထမဆံုး phpmyadmin ကုိသြားပါမယ္ ။
ဒီေနရာမွာ ပံုနဲ႕ ရွင္းျပထားတာကေတာ့ Localhost နဲ႕ ျပထားပါတယ္ ။
မိမိလုပ္ထားတဲ့ hosting ေပၚမူတည္ၿပီး ပံု ပံုစံနည္းနည္းေျပာင္ေနနုိင္ပါတယ္ ။
အဓိကနားလည္ေအာင္ ၾကည့္ထားဖို႕ပါပဲ ။အားလံုးတူတူပါပဲ ။
Popularity: 11% [?]


